How can companies measure the effectiveness of their efforts to incorporate customer-centric values into their organizational culture, and what steps can they take to continuously improve and evolve their customer satisfaction strategies over time?
Companies can measure the effectiveness of their customer-centric values by tracking key performance indicators such as customer satisfaction scores, retention rates, and customer feedback. They can also conduct regular surveys and focus groups to gather insights from customers. To continuously improve and evolve their customer satisfaction strategies, companies can analyze data to identify areas for improvement, implement changes based on customer feedback, and regularly review and update their strategies to stay aligned with customer needs and preferences. Additionally, fostering a culture of continuous learning and innovation within the organization can help drive ongoing improvements in customer satisfaction.
